Transaction 670270f4026dc881bc37b25e41e97d390415bca56696ecfc3a7f8af80faadaf6
1 Input
1 Output
-
670270f4026dc881bc37b25e41e97d390415bca56696ecfc3a7f8af80faadaf6:0
- value
- 6492915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be27e116f83130e41d2fef1281a4c3af2e7ae328 OP_EQUAL
- address
- 3K2U5rJaDqfTckPxgukUN3o4Cq5J5NEK3w